overpriced machines,

you can replicated this, the machine they use is an AMS brand, get one from a reputable distribute, AP and Crane are also good. You could also find a used machine, I reccomend the Ap 7600 or 113 for its durability.

Then get a local artist and viynl shop to do the graphics, and wrap and presto, you got your machine

then go to your local harbor freight or equivalent el cheapo chinese import tool shop, and take then to a welder or fab shop and have them make you the mounting post and loop the wires to secure the tools.

also, if this need to be outside you will want to get the waterproof ams that is rated for outdoor use, if you dont and you shock someone, your ass is toast.

you could also install all sots of hasps cages steel covers etc to keep you machine safe, even safer than the one in the video if you pit enough feature on.

 then get the supplies, talk to local bike shops, dollar stores, etc.

you could even try to partner with bike shops and use their branding, with permission
